ABOUT THE ROLE

Reporting to the Chief Strategy Officer (CSO), we seek a dynamic and entrepreneurial Partnerships Manager. Your primary responsibility will be to develop and lead our academic partnerships program. This role is crucial in establishing relationships with universities, colleges, and law schools to incorporate the Spellbook product into their curricula. The successful candidate will create this program from scratch, building strong relationships with academic institutions while developing strategies with the product, marketing, and customer success teams to efficiently and cost-effectively onboard students onto our platform.

In addition to managing academic partnerships, as a partner to the Chief Strategy Officer, you will be personally involved in identifying commercial partnerships, evaluating and proposing deals, managing CRM data, and assisting in negotiating and closing deals. After closing, you will help manage the strategic partnership relationship cycle and align our partnership activities with the broader team's plans. The CSO will also assign you special projects to drive improvements across the company.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Create and implement a comprehensive strategy for establishing and growing the academic partnerships program, specifically with university and college law programs and law schools worldwide.

  • Build and maintain strong relationships with key stakeholders in law programs and law schools, including deans, faculty, and administrative staff, to drive collaboration and mutual success.

  • Work with marketing and sales teams to execute partner programs, events, and sales engagement and build playbooks and collateral to enable academic partners to co-promote effectively.

  • Identify, evaluate, and prioritize strategic academic partnerships and opportunities that enhance our market reach and competitive position within the legal sector.

  • Assist the CSO in finding, evaluating and proposing non-academic partnerships, channel partners and alliances to support business growth.

  • Support the CSO and assist the negotiation process, ensuring agreements align with our strategic goals and financial objectives. Manage contracts and close partnership deals, focusing on creating long-term value for both parties.

  • Work closely with internal teams, including marketing, sales, and product development, to align partnership activities with broader business strategies and ensure that partnerships enhance product offerings and customer experiences.

  • Prepare regular reports on partnership strategy and its impact on the business for senior management. Use data-driven insights to refine partnership strategies and objectives.

  • Maintain all partnership documentation and ensure current renewals, reporting, and commitments to our partners.

  • Develop and implement joint go-to-market initiatives with academic partners to maximize the potential for student and faculty engagement with our platform.
